## Break-glass access — Orphan Sweeper (Team Larkmoor)

The Hollowtide orphaned-resource sweeper reclaims unattached volumes nightly. If it deletes something still in use, you have a four-hour restore window. Break-glass is for that window only: page the steward, log intent in the incident doc, then open the restore console. Access is sealed behind a single-use session. Unseal it with the recovery passphrase below.

recovery phrase for fafof-kagaf: eliath-zormir

Welcome to the Brindlepath tooling team! One thing you'll use daily is Slabview, our diff viewer built for huge files — it streams chunks instead of loading everything, so 2 GB logs diff fine. It runs as an internal service, so you'll need to authenticate your CLI first. Drop the following key into your Slabview config.

API key for fadug-fafof: kto7_7rjklQM

## Step 4: Timezone normalization in report exports

Starting with Quillforge 3.2, all scheduled report exports are rendered in UTC rather than the tenant's locale. Before promoting the build, the release manager must confirm that the export worker on each node has the normalization flags set, otherwise legacy tenants in the Varnholt region will see shifted timestamps. Apply the following settings to the export worker before restart.

settings of tagef-bawif:
DRUIX_HOST=druix.zemvarlabs.internal
DRUIX_PORT=8000

Ticket QX-2214: Encoding-detection workers failing to connect

Since the Thornfield 3.2 rollout, the charset-detection service for uploaded text files intermittently drops its pool connections mid-scan, leaving files flagged as undetected. We suspect the pool idle timeout conflicts with the detector's batch cadence. To reproduce against staging, use the connection string below.

warehouse DSN: mssql://rusdor_svc:0FSWCn9@db-951a.paliqforge.local:5432/ulawyn